Watch Miami Heat's Jimmy Butler Inspire Young Fan In China

In this story:
Miami Heat forward Jimmy Butler recently wrapped up his tour of China to help promote his partnership with Li-Ning clothing apparel.
Before leaving, he was treated to one young fan explaining how Butler and the Heat's run to the NBA Finals was inspirational.
"When I tried to give up, I reminded myself how you performed in the playoffs this season," the fan told Butler. "Your strength taught me how to face challenges. Even our team lost in the school tournament, I think we will be much better just as you did."

The Heat made history by becoming just the second No. 8 seed to make the Finals, joining the 1999 New York Knicks. They lost to the Denver Nuggets in five games but are expected once again as one of the top contenders in the league next season.
